Fall in love with this most enchanting venue, full of quintessential charm. Steeped in character, its unique history will encase guests and create intimate, memorable celebrations full of relaxed, fun vibes. One of the oldest Town Houses in the country built around 1530, the much-loved venue became the first village hall to be licensed for civil marriages in 1996. 

Over the years, it has undergone various refurbishments to provide a wonderful setting for intimate weddings. The beautiful wooden beamed 16th-century building is surrounded by landlocked Cambridgeshire and in the quaint little village of Barley. It’s a delightful setting for anyone hoping for enchanting, quintessentially English weddings. The venue, much like the idyllic village surrounding it, is a perfect backdrop for memorable photo opportunities and has an intimate, nostalgic and timeless feel. There’s a small outside space at the front of the building for guests to gather and have photos with a beautiful backdrop made possible with Barley’s Church – a small donation is required. 

The Town House is ideal for ceremonies and wedding receptions. The Under-croft is licensed for the vows, accommodating up to 70 seated guests, followed by wedding breakfasts and receptions to dance the night away upstairs without guests having to travel. It’s the ideal space for between 15 to 80 people. Alternatively, exchange vows at the Town House and walk to the local pub, The Fox and Hound. Featured in the Michelin Guide, it has a warm, homely yet luxurious atmosphere that pays homage to the traditional pub. Here, pairs will be served delicious seasonal British produce before returning to the Town House to party the night away. 

Barley Town House has three beautiful wooden-beamed rooms for couples to put their individual stamp on, a large kitchen, a reception area and great facilities. The team are proud to have a tried and tested little black book of amazing, recommended suppliers. This includes an in-house coordinator for an additional cost, Hayley, at Dollys Vintage who is on hand to help in any way she can.
